How they compare
Barbados currently reports 3,155 against 3,066 in French Polynesia, a difference of 89.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 74 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Barbados ahead.
Barbados ranks 187th and French Polynesia ranks 188th of 229 countries.
Across the 8 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 4 and French Polynesia in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Barbados | French Polynesia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 7,369 | 3,048 | 4,321 | Barbados |
| 1960s | 7,334 | 3,914 | 3,420 | Barbados |
| 1970s | 5,194 | 4,409 | 785 | Barbados |
| 1980s | 4,032 | 5,422 | 1,390 | French Polynesia |
| 1990s | 3,882 | 5,316 | 1,435 | French Polynesia |
| 2000s | 3,633 | 4,814 | 1,181 | French Polynesia |
| 2010s | 3,326 | 4,129 | 803.7 | French Polynesia |
| 2020s | 3,177 | 3,170 | 7 | Barbados |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
